“…A refined firstorder shear deformation theory for layered composites and sandwich structure was proposed by Mantari and Ore. 17 The results showed that the proposed theory was more accurate and effective in solving the dynamic characteristics of single-layer and sandwich composite plates than the existing first-order shear deformation theory. Zhai et al [18][19][20] derived the vibration differential equation of composite viscoelastic sandwich plates and shells by shear deformation principle and variational method, and discussed the influence of material structure and properties on their vibration characteristics. Li et al [21][22][23] established the theoretical equation of composite sandwich cylindrical shell and explored its nonlinear dynamic characteristics.…”

“…With its excellent damping effect, CLD has been widely used in applications related to marines, vehicles and aerospace industries, but there is still a lack of its investigation and application in rail transit bridge engineering. 17 Analytical methods are developed to investigate the dynamic performance of simple beams, plates and cylindrical shells damped with viscoelastic layer, [18][19][20][21][22][23] but due to the complexity of geometric configuration and boundary conditions of steel bridges, it will be an arduous task. The finite element (FE) modeling is a good approach, which has been widely applied to analyze the vibrational behavior of structures with viscoelastic layer.…”
